Meaning

Bamboo field or middle of the bamboo grove

Represents stability, resilience, and harmony with nature, symbolizing endurance and quiet strength through the imagery of bamboo.

Symbolism

Embodies growth, flexibility under pressure, and natural elegance; associated with rural tranquility and ancestral roots.

Etymology: Derived from the Japanese words 'take' (bamboo) and 'naka' (middle or within), indicating someone who lived in or near a bamboo grove, often used as a topographic surname.
